“Small antique mall with a wide variety of quality, mid-range items. Per-item prices between a few bucks and a few hundred. Not at all unreasonable. (Please bear in mind that this is an antique store - not a thrift store or flea market - in the Hamptons, so it's very good pricing, all things considered. And items are tagged, which is not necessarily a given at an antiques store.) In addition to the main space, there is a "barn" in back, plus there are a few items outside. It is somewhat tight quarters - typical antique/secondhand store - so it may not be physically accessible for everyone. Friendly employees. I'm quite happy with my finds and will definitely return the next time I'm in the area.”
